A Herd Of Rhinos

A Herd of Rhinos is a magnificent sight, a captivating gathering of these massive creatures roaming the vast grasslands and expansive African savannas. This collective noun phrase refers to a group of rhinoceros, one of the world's largest land animals, coming together in social bonds and forming a cohesive unit.

When encountering a herd of rhinos, one is instantly struck by their imposing stature and strength. With their thick, grey skins, squat legs, and iconic horns, these marvelous creatures command a sense of authority and presence in their surroundings. Whether grazing peacefully or charging through the terrain with tremendous power, a Herd of Rhinos emanates an air of awe-inspiring primal energy.

Within a rhino herd, a hierarchical structure often exists, with an alpha male acting as the dominant leader. Other individuals, including females and younger rhinos, generally form a protective circle around the leader, creating a sense of unity and strength in numbers. As a united force, the herd acts as a formidable deterrent to any potential threats or predators, exemplifying their collective resilience and determination.

By banding together in herds, rhinoceroses are able to share resources and provide mutual support. They communicate among themselves through a combination of gestures, ritualized behaviors, and vocalizations, signaling their intentions and maintaining social cohesion. Additionally, herds allow rhinos to increase their odds of survival, as multiple sets of eyes and ears are better equipped to detect danger, ensuring the protection and safety of each member.

Sadly, the conservation status of rhinos has been endangered due to illegal poaching and habitat loss. Instances of herds being poached for their valuable horns have caused significant declines in their populations, threatening their very existence. As such, preserving and protecting colonies of rhinos is of paramount importance to ensure the survival of these incredible and magnificent creatures.

Overall, a herd of rhinos epitomizes the strength, unity, and resilience exhibited by these extraordinary animals. It is a captivating sight which reminds us of the vital importance of conservation efforts and underscores the need to safeguard their habitats for future generations to cherish and appreciate the grandeur of a herd of rhinos.
